MOREHEAD STATE COLLEGE MARCHING BAND In the fall of 1956, the Marching Band opened the fall sea- son with 18 members. Because of the very hard work of Fred Marzan, director, and the many loyal students, the band has increased until this year the number was over 130. Not only the number of members but also the fine quality of performance has caused the band to be recognized as one of the finest marching bands in this part of the nation. Last year the president of Lions International heard the band at the Kentucky Derby and was so impressed that he invited the band to represent his organization at its International Convention in Nice, France, in 1962. SUCCESSFUL SE S 4 LOSSES V Eagles down Eastern . . . The 1960 Morehead football season was a great success as it marked the first time since 1949 that the Eagles finished above the .500 mark. By spilling Eastern and Western in their last two outings, the Eagles reached a high-water mark in the last ten years of conference play. It WHS the first time since joining the O.V.C. in 1948, that Morehead had defeated Western. In defeating Eastern, the Eagles regained the prized Hawg Rifle for the first time since 1949.
